Understanding Sound Profiles

A sound profile refers to the collection of sounds within your environment, including background noise, keyboard sounds, and other ambient noises. Proper customization can help you either block out distracting sounds or introduce calming noises that enhance focus.

Key Elements of a Comfortable Sound Profile

  • Background Noise: Consistent ambient sounds that mask disruptive noises.
  • Keyboard Sounds: The noise produced by your keyboard, which can be either distracting or satisfying depending on your preference.
  • Notifications and Alerts: Sounds from applications that can interrupt focus if not managed properly.
  • External Noises: Environmental sounds such as traffic, conversations, or household activity.

Best Sound Profile Customizations

Using White Noise or Nature Sounds

Playing white noise or nature sounds can effectively mask distracting environmental noises. Many apps and devices offer customizable soundscapes that loop seamlessly, creating a consistent background that promotes focus.

Adjusting Keyboard Sound Settings

If your keyboard produces loud clicks, consider switching to quieter models or enabling sound-dampening features. Some mechanical keyboards allow you to customize or disable clicking sounds, reducing auditory distractions.

Managing Notification Sounds

Disable or customize notification sounds on your device to prevent interruptions. Many operating systems allow you to mute or selectively enable sounds for specific apps, helping maintain a steady workflow.

Tools and Devices for Sound Profile Customization

Several tools can assist in creating an optimal sound environment:

  • Noise-Canceling Headphones: Block out external sounds and play your preferred background noise.
  • Sound Machines: Generate consistent ambient sounds such as rain, ocean waves, or white noise.
  • Sound Editing Apps: Customize and filter sounds to suit your preferences.
  • Operating System Settings: Manage system sounds and notifications efficiently.
